小程序显示外链图片135
小程序作为一种轻量级应用,在开发过程中经常需要显示外链图片。然而,由于小程序的沙箱特性,直接使用外链图片会导致跨域问题。为了解决这一问题,小程序提供了多种方法来显示外链图片。
方法一:使用跨域模块
小程序提供了cross-origin模块来处理跨域请求。该模块支持两种方式:和。
:通过Fetch API发送跨域请求,返回一个Promise,可获取请求结果。
:发送跨域请求,返回一个Promise,可获取请求结果和响应头信息。
方法二:使用图片代理
另一种方法是使用图片代理。图片代理是一种中介服务,它可以将外部图片资源代理到小程序中。小程序可以通过代理服务器的地址来访问外部图片,从而绕过跨域限制。
使用图片代理时,需要考虑代理服务器的稳定性、速度和安全性。推荐使用官方提供的图片代理服务,如和tcb-image。
方法三:使用Canvas绘图
对于需要动态显示外链图片的情况,可以使用Canvas绘图。Canvas绘图可以将外链图片绘制到Canvas画布上,然后通过将其转化为临时文件路径。小程序可以将临时文件路径作为图片源,显示在页面上。
使用Canvas绘图时,需要考虑手机性能和图片大小对渲染速度的影响。
方法四:使用其他工具或插件
除了上述方法之外,还有各种工具和插件可以帮助小程序显示外链图片。这些工具和插件通常提供更便捷的开发方式,但需要注意它们的维护和兼容性。
安全注意事项
在显示外链图片时,需要格外注意安全问题。外链图片可能来自不可信源,存在恶意代码或图像欺骗等安全风险。建议对外部图片进行安全检查,如验证图片来源、检查图片内容是否符合规范等。
结语
小程序显示外链图片有四种主要方法:跨域模块、图片代理、Canvas绘图和第三方工具或插件。开发者可以根据具体场景选择合适的方法,并注意外链图片的安全问题。通过合理利用这些方法,开发者可以轻松地将外链图片显示在小程序中,丰富用户的体验。
2024-12-09
上一篇:友情链接共享外部流量
新文章

小程序外链地址获取与应用技巧详解

H5客服外链:提升用户体验的便捷沟通利器

H5客服外链:提升用户体验与转化率的利器

外链建设:提升网站权重与流量的有效策略

提升网站权重和流量:深度解析外链发布的必要性

图床外链自适应:解决图片显示兼容性问题的终极指南

图床外链自适应:解决图片显示难题的终极指南

外链建设的八大方向:提升网站权重和SEO的策略指南

外链建设的八大方向及策略详解

微信外部链接限制:原因、应对策略及未来趋势
热门文章

如何解除 QQ 空间图片外链限制?

外链推广网站汇总

外链与反链:理解网络中的链接关系

图床的选择与使用:为你的图片找到安身之所

文件外链源码:揭秘网站资源托管的秘密

脚本外链制作教程 | 一步步掌握脚本外链的方法

如何获取文件外链?

大悲咒:解读其神奇力量与正确持诵方法

网易云音乐外链生成及使用详解:图文教程与常见问题解答
